🔴10 Popular Food Mistakes That Damage Your Metabolism (and More)


1. Skipping Breakfast

What is wrong with skipping breakfast
Skipping Breakfast? Think again!
  • Why it hurts: 

    Your metabolism slows down to conserve energy, and blood sugar can crash later in the day.

  • Also affects: Focus, hormone balance, and appetite control.


2. Eating Too Many Ultra-Processed Foods

  • Why it hurts: 

    These are often high in sugar, unhealthy fats, and additives that inflame the body and confuse hunger signals.

  • Also affects: Gut flora, immune response, and inflammation.


3. Relying on “Low-Fat” Packaged Products

  • Why it hurts: 

    Low-fat products often contain extra sugars or starches that spike insulin and promote fat storage.

  • Also affects: Heart health and hormonal balance.


4. Late-Night Eating

  • Why it hurts: 

    Your body naturally winds down in the evening. Eating late disrupts blood sugar rhythms and fat metabolism.

  • Also affects: Sleep quality and digestion.


5. Not Eating Enough Protein

  • Why it hurts: 

    Protein helps maintain lean muscle, which burns more calories even at rest.

  • Also affects: Immune strength and tissue repair.


6. Too Much Sugar and Refined Carbohydrates

  • Why it hurts: 

    Causes blood sugar spikes, insulin resistance, and long-term metabolic slowdown.

  • Also affects: Blood vessels, gut balance, and inflammation levels.


7. Drinking Your Calories (Soda, Juice, Sweet Coffee Drinks)

  • Why it hurts: 

    Liquid sugar doesn’t fill you up and goes straight to the liver — promoting fat gain and insulin spikes.

  • Also affects: Liver function and triglyceride levels.


8. Constant Snacking

  • Why it hurts: 

    Keeps insulin levels elevated and prevents your body from entering fat-burning mode.

  • Also affects: Digestive rest and gut function.


9. Eating Under Stress or Distraction

  • Why it hurts: 

    Stress hormones impair digestion and metabolism. You also tend to eat more without realizing it.

  • Also affects: Nutrient absorption and immune response.


10. Ignoring Gut Health

  • Why it hurts: 

    A damaged or imbalanced gut affects everything — from nutrient absorption to energy production and immunity.

  • Also affects: Mood, detoxification, and metabolic flexibility.


🟢 10 Food Habits That Boost Your Metabolism and Protect Your Body


1. Eat a Protein-Rich Breakfast

  • Why it helps: Activates metabolism early and keeps hunger in check.

  • Best choices: Eggs, cottage cheese, Greek yogurt, protein smoothies with greens.


2. Choose Whole, Colorful Foods

  • Why it helps: Antioxidants, fiber, and phytonutrients reduce inflammation and support healthy metabolism.

  • Try: Leafy greens, berries, beets, broccoli, sweet potatoes.


3. Embrace Healthy Fats

  • Why it helps: Fats like omega-3s help regulate hormones and fuel long-lasting energy.

  • Best picks: Olive oil, walnuts, avocado, wild salmon, flaxseed.


4. Support Your Gut Daily

  • Why it helps: A healthy microbiome improves digestion, immunity, and fat-burning signals.

  • Add: Sauerkraut, kefir, yogurt, prebiotic-rich veggies like leeks and garlic.


5. Hydrate Before You Eat

  • Why it helps: Water helps enzymes work efficiently and can reduce overeating.

  • Bonus tip: Try warm lemon water in the morning to gently stimulate digestion.


6. Time Your Meals

  • Why it helps: Eating at consistent times stabilizes blood sugar and hormones.

  • Try: A 12–14 hour overnight fast to give your system time to reset.


7. Eat Mindfully

  • Why it helps: Chewing well and relaxing before meals improves digestion and satisfaction.

  • Simple practice: Pause, breathe, and be present during meals.


8. Add Fiber to Every Meal

  • Why it helps: Fiber balances blood sugar, feeds good bacteria, and supports detox.

  • Top sources: Lentils, chia seeds, berries, leafy greens, whole oats.


9. Use Metabolism-Boosting Spices

  • Why it helps: Many spices gently raise body temperature and help burn more calories.

  • Use more: Ginger, turmeric, cayenne, cinnamon, and black pepper.


10. Cook More at Home

  • Why it helps: You control ingredients, avoid harmful additives, and build healthier routines.

  • Try: Simple, balanced plates with protein, fat, fiber, and colorful veggies.
